Installing a new HVAC system involves several variables that shift the final total. The square footage of your home and the necessary cooling capacity—measured in tons—are the biggest factors. You also have to consider the efficiency rating of the unit, the complexity of your existing ductwork, and whether you need to upgrade electrical or gas lines to accommodate the new equipment. The AC installation process in Paterson typically begins with a site evaluation to determine the correct system size and type. The pros will then remove the old unit if necessary, install the new condenser and evaporator coil, connect refrigerant lines and electrical wiring, and test the system. This methodical approach ensures optimal performance and safety.
